Travel Safety Checklist

Many people at Lund University travel abroad, sometimes to areas with increased security risks. With the right preparation unnecessary risks can be minimised. This checklist is for those travelling and their managers, and its content is useful whether you are travelling within Sweden or abroad. "Materize" by Sól Ey / Make Sound Residency

16 to 22 February 2024 Using her homemade wearable instrument Hreyfð, Sól Ey has been working on a new performance for 4 dancers called Materize. The instrument is the result of Sól Ey’s extensive research on instruments that create sounds with gestures. Exchange studies

Since the early nineties the Faculty of Law has actively taken part in the exchange programmes for law students within the European Union.
